William "Will" H. St. Sauver

william

March 28, 1983 ~ July 6, 2014

William H. Will St. Sauver Age 31 of Scandia, passed away July 6, 2014 following injuries sustained a car accident. He is preceded in death by his father, William C. St. Sauver on December 12, 2013; grandparents, Henry R. Vietor; Lorraine Theresa (Olinger) and William Louis St. Sauver. Will will be deeply missed by daughter, Madison St. Sauver; mom, Ellen (Vietor) St. Sauver; sister, Julie (Mike) Fulton; nieces and nephews, Nellie Fulton, Henry Fulton, Mikey Fulton, and William Fulton; grandmother, Lois Vietor; aunts, uncles, cousins and friends. Gathering of family and friends 4:00-8:00 PM Thursday, July 10th at Roberts Family Funeral Home, 555 Centennial Dr. SW, Forest Lake. Celebration of Wills Life 11:00 AM Friday, July 11th at Faith Lutheran Church, 886 No. Shore Dr., Forest Lake with a gathering beginning at 10:00 AM until time of service. Interment St. John the Baptist Cemetery, Hugo.
